Inclusion Criteria

Patients aged 18 to 60 years who have been diagnosed with type 1 bipolar disorder according to DSM-V criteria (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, 5th edition) have referred to Ibn Sina Hospital with symptoms of mania since February 1, 2022.
Satisfaction with inclusion in the study

Exclusion Criteria

Prior knowledge of blue block glasses
History of migraine
Symptoms of quitting or abusing alcohol or any other medication
